The Election Commission of India (ECI) informed the Supreme Court today (2 February) that it does not recognise Edappadi Palaniswami (EPS) as the interim general secretary of the All India Anna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am (AIADMK).
EPS had got himself declared as the interim general secretary during the general council meeting in July 2022, in which O Panneerselvam (OPS) and his supporters were expelled.
Before this meeting, OPS was the Coordinator and EPS was the Joint Coordinator of the party.
The ECI response said that it did not recognise the new designation of EPS because the meeting itself has been challenged by OPS in the Supreme Court and the Court is yet to give its final judgement.
If the ECI had recognised EPS as interim general secretary, only his signature would be necessary for the nomination form.
Prior to this, according to the party constitution, both of them used to sign nomination forms for party candidates in their capacity of Coordinator and Joint Coordinator respectively.
Regarding the 'two-leaves' symbol, the ECI said that neither faction had approached it under the Election Symbols (Reservation and Allotment) Order,1968 to notify it of a dispute.
